Garage exit design refers to the planning and construction of the exit areas of residential or commercial garages. This includes considerations for safety, accessibility, traffic flow, and integration with the surrounding environment. Key aspects involve the width and length of the exit, signage, lighting, and compliance with local building codes.

Garage ventilation window design refers to the architectural and engineering solutions used to ensure proper air circulation and ventilation within a garage. This can include the placement, size, and type of windows, as well as the use of automated or manual opening mechanisms. Proper ventilation is crucial to prevent the buildup of harmful fumes and maintain a safe environment.

The design of garage entrance and exit ramps involves considerations of slope gradients, safety features, accessibility, and aesthetics. It typically includes the selection of appropriate materials, ensuring compliance with local building codes, and incorporating features like handrails, signage, and lighting. Good design should facilitate smooth vehicle entry and exit while minimizing the risk of accidents and ensuring ease of use for all users, including those with disabilities.

Parking garage ground design refers to the planning and construction of the floor surface in parking garages. It involves considerations such as load-bearing capacity, drainage, anti-slip properties, and aesthetic appearance. Key aspects include selecting appropriate flooring materials, ensuring proper slope for water drainage, and incorporating safety features to prevent accidents.
